Tutorial: Colouring in small areas with Copics - clothes (dull creamy yellow and greyish purple)

I am back to colouring up Kitty Katastrophy from Whimsy Stamps. For those of you in Europe and UK she is available HERE in Quixotic Paperie.

The card I am using is Make It Colour marker blending card from Make It Crafty and no, I am not being paid to say so. It is genuinely my favorite cardstock for Copic work at the moment.

I would actually call it more so a colouring video than a tutorial. A lot of babbling, as usual.

Markers needed:
YR21, YR23, Y28, E97
and
BV20/23/25/29
